Abstract

Enantioselective enzymatic hydrolysis of benzoyl-benzoin catalyzed by Candida cylindracea (CCL) lipase was carried out in SCCO 2. It was found that CCL lipase enantioselectively hydrolyzed the ( R)-benzoin. The enantiomeric excess of product (ee p) was maximized at 35 °C near the critical region 90 bar and obtained 61.3% at a 50% conversion. CCL did not catalyze the reaction in an atmospherical condition.
